I once took my class outdoors and positioned the students at various points on a hillside. I asked them to point in the direction of greatest slope away from the point where they stood, extending their arms far from their bodies or near, according as they thought the maximum slope was large or small. To convey the idea... | 677.169 | 1 |

Introduction
In this chapter, we will analyze two new types of functions, exponents and logarithms. Up until now, the variable has been the base, with numbers in the exponent; linear, quadratic, cubic, etc. Exponential functions have the variable in the expon... | 677.169 | 1 |
